**CI note: timezone weirdness in report exports**

Heads up, support folks — if a customer says their Ledgerpine export shows times shifted by a few hours, it's probably the CI image. The export workers got rebuilt last week and the base image defaults to UTC, while older workers used the account's locale. Fix is rolling out; meanwhile tell customers the data itself is fine, just the display offset. Affected exports carry the build token shown below.

build token for bajof-tahop: htk4_a981

Runbook: Account Recovery — Gatewatch Occupancy Feed

Plugin authors locked out of the Gatewatch sandbox: stop polling immediately. Revoke your stale session from the partner console. Request a recovery window; approval is automatic within the hour. Do not re-register your plugin ID — that orphans your occupancy subscriptions for the Harrowfield garage tier. Once the window opens, authenticate with the recovery flow. Enter the passphrase shown below exactly.

unlock words, hahip-yagef: zorok-novmir-zorix-silax

Step 6 — Rebuild the autocomplete index. After the Lintaro service deploys, the typeahead index for product names will be cold and queries may take several seconds for the first hour. To avoid this, run the warmer job from the ops box before flipping traffic. The warmer reads its settings from the standard env file and authenticates against the index broker. Add the following line to that env file before running it.

vault entry, kafog-yahop: COURIER_KEY8=0faa53ae

## Tuning

The revamped reset flow in Fernlock replaces the old single-use link with a short-lived code plus a signed continuation token. Throttling happens at two layers: per-account request caps and a global issuance ceiling that protects the mailer queue. All values were validated against the Harrowgate load profile; deviating from them requires re-running that suite. The constants the flow ships with are defined below.

limits module of fajog-tawig:
RATE_LIMITS = {
    "druwyn": 2,
    "quenael": 10,
    "wenix": 2,
    "druael": 2,
}